Transaction 762831bde3a931a44bb70ef98eebae50987b2ed0f31befc69af71e29fde615c1
1 Input
1 Output
-
762831bde3a931a44bb70ef98eebae50987b2ed0f31befc69af71e29fde615c1:0
- value
- 383986
- script pubkey
- OP_0 OP_PUSHBYTES_20 cae9df5ae93297bd86dc73ef9b88aacefe51e081
- address
- bc1qet5a7khfx2tmmpkuw0hehz92eml9rcypjh85cp